Parbhane, Mali Ritesh Nagnath [googlescholar] => [doi] => [year] => 2025 [month] => June [volume] => 10 [issue] => 6 [file] => fm/jpanel/upload/2025/June/202506-02-022307.pdf [abstract] => Folic acid, an BCS class IV essential nutrient, having low solubility and permeability, limiting its bioavailability and therapeutic efficiency. This study aims to enhance folic acid solubility and permeability through solid dispersion and inclusion complex formation utilizing Gelucire 50/13 and hydroxypropyl-beta-cyclodextrin. Solid dispersions of folic acid with Gelucire 50/13 (1:4 ratios) increased solubility by 8.5 fold, respectively. Using HP-β-CD to create inclusion complexes increased permeability by 20-30 fold. These data illustrate the potential of this combination method to considerably increase folic acid solubility and permeability.These results show that this combined method has the potential to greatly improve folic acid solubility and permeability, hence increasing its bioavailability and therapeutic potential.
